Facing jail for deadly wiring
A FARM worker whose girlfriend was electrocuted after he drunkenly rewired their kitchen faces jail.
James Atkin, 43, had left the mobile home he shared with Deana Simpson in a “dangerous condition”.
Deana, 40, died when she touched the cooker.
Atkin, of Willoughby, Warks, was found guilty of manslaughter by jurors at Warwick crown court.
Judge Sylv ia de Bertodano told him he would “very likely” go to prison when sentenced.
